Are there any states where the non-titled, non-borrowing spouse signs refi docs?

Reply by Kay/IL on 9/22/10 11:01pm
Msg #353517

In Illinois, non-titled, non-borrowing spouses MUST sign the Truth in Lending, Right to Cancel, Itemization of Amount Financed (if present in the loan package) and Mortgage. A few additional lending and title documents may be included, but those are the basics.
